Introduction to the Political Financing Handbook for Candidates and Official Agents
This handbook is designed to assist candidates and their official agents. It is a tool that will help in administering the candidate's campaign during the electoral campaign process.
This document is a general guideline issued pursuant to section 16.1 of the Canada Elections Act. It is provided for information and is not intended to replace the Act.
Elections Canada will review the contents of this handbook on a regular basis and make updates as required.
The handbook consists of six chapters:
- Starting the Candidate's Campaign
- Campaign Inflows
- Campaign Outflows
- Reporting Requirements
- Closing the Candidate's Campaign
- By-elections superseded by a general election
The topics are presented in the order of a typical candidate's electoral campaign process.
